SharePoint …Sep 12, 2022 · OneDrive is your own personal storage. This is where you'll want to put documents and files that you don’t want other people in your organization to access. SharePoint, on the other hand, is your collaborative cloud storage. This is where you would store a document in which you want to collaborate with a group of co-workers. With so many collaboration tools available, it can be overwhelming to choose the right one f...If you are working on a file by yourself, save it to OneDrive. Your OneDrive files are private unless you share them with others. If multiple individuals and teams need to work on documents and products at the same time, then, SharePoint is where you should save your files.
